Design features and types of inflatable floor
To understand why a boat with NDND behaves differently on the go, you need to understand the anatomy of the bottom. There are two main types of design: AirDeck (flat inflatable floor) and AirBoat (bottom with inflatable tubes-ribs of stiffness). The first option is a single inflatable stove that unfolds inside the cylinders. The second option is more complex and resembles the structure. keel a vessel where the inflatable tubes create a V-shaped profile.
The key element here is kielson It's a rigid longitudinal beam that runs along the bottom, and in inflatable boats, the quilson is often built into the structure itself, or is a removable element that is inserted into a special pocket, which provides longitudinal rigidity and prevents the bow from picking up when glides, and without a high-quality kilson, even with a powerful motor, it will be impossible to get into the plane with a passenger.

Comparison: inflatable floor (BND) vs. Payolny (PDP)
The eternal boating debate: which is better? To make a good decision, let's compare performance. The solder bottom (PDP) gives you the feeling of a "concrete" platform. You can stand on it full-length without fear of bending. But the price of that comfort is weight and build time. float-bottom Loses in the rigidity of the platform "on dry", but wins in driving performance on the water.
When you move on the wave, the NDND boat slaps less. The hard bottom of the solder boat, when it hits the water, makes a characteristic loud sound and transmits vibration to the board. The inflatable structure extinguishes these impacts. In addition, the thermal conductivity of the inflated floor is lower: sitting on it without an additional mat, you will freeze not as quickly as on cold plywood.
From the point of view of aerodynamics and hydrodynamics, a well-assembled boat with NDND and high-quality quillson It's more streamlined, and the inflated bottom cylinders move smoothly into the sides, creating less water resistance, and this allows you to achieve higher speeds at the same power. boat-engine.

Choosing a motor for an inflatable floor boat
Powertrain selection is critical. DHLD boats are generally lighter than their mutually-powered counterparts, so they require less horsepower to get to the plane. But there's a subtlety: the center of gravity. The inflated bottom is higher than the thin floorboard, which can slightly raise the center of gravity of the entire structure.
For models with a length of 320-360 cm, the best choice will be motors with a capacity of 5-9.9 hp This is enough to bring 2-3 people and equipment to planing. When you install the motor on a boat with NDND, use an additional transom slab made of aluminum or stainless steel, which will distribute the load from the engine over a large area of the inflated cylinder, preventing its deformation and prolonging the life of the transom.
For large boats (380-420 cm) with an inflatable floor, engines from 15 hp and above are often recommended. But remember about the passport power. Exceeding the recommended engine power can lead to the detachment of the transom or the destruction of the bottom structure at high speed, which can lead to rollover.

Materials and quality of manufacture
The durability of the boat is directly dependent on the quality of the PVC fabric. Inflatable bottoms are more dense than cylinders, often with reinforcement. The standard density is 750-850 g/m2, but for professional models the bottom can be strengthened to 1100 g/m2. This provides protection from puncture and abrasion.
Pay attention to the type of seams. In quality boats, the seams are glued by the method. hot-vulcanization Or two-part glue bonding, which is not afraid of water or temperature changes, and cheap boats, where the seams are simply threaded or cold-stitched, can start poisoning the air after the first season of active operation.

Secrets of PVC durability
Modern PVC fabrics contain special UV filters, but they don't last forever. After every fishing trip, especially on a sunny day, try to rinse the boat with fresh water. Salt and silt, when dried on the fabric, work as an abrasive and catalyst for the destruction of polymers under the influence of the sun.
The color of the material matters, too: Light colors (gray, light green) are less heated in the sun, which keeps the comfort inside the boat and reduces the risk of overheating. Dark colors (camouflage, dark blue) better mask the boat on the water, but heat up more, requiring constant pressure monitoring.
Operating rules and care for BNDT
The maintenance of an inflatable floor boat has its own specifications, the main task is to maintain the tightness and elasticity of the material. After each operation, the boat must be dried. The moisture left between the inflatable floor and the outer cylinders can lead to mold and unpleasant odor, which is then difficult to get rid of.
Pumping should be carried out strictly according to the manufacturer's recommendations, usually 0.2-0.25 atmospheres. The use of a pressure gauge is mandatory! Pumping "peephole" often leads to either underperformance (the boat is sluggish, poorly controlled) or to pumping (the risk of rupture of seams). When the temperature changes, the pressure inside the cylinders changes: in the sun it grows, in the cold it falls.

FAQ: Frequently asked questions
Can a fire be lit in a boat with an inflatable floor or a gas burner be used?
It is strongly discouraged to place gas burners or primuses directly on the inflated bottom without special thermal protection. Although modern materials are resistant to short-term contact with fire, sparks or prolonged heating can melt PVC or disrupt the glue seam. Use special tables mounted on the sides or stand with a heat-reflecting screen.
How hard is it to break the bottom of the rocks?
It is quite difficult to penetrate a modern inflatable floor (especially with a density of 850 g/m2 and above) with a regular sharp stone. The material is highly elastic: it bends around an obstacle, rather than piercing. However, sharp edges of shells, sticking out fittings or spikes can damage the fabric. For such reservoirs, it is better to use protective linings or Kevlar tape on the bottom.
Is the boat sailing hard with NDND in the wind?
Sailing depends primarily on the height of the balloons inflated and the presence of an awning, not the type of bottom. However, boats with NDND often have higher sides to compensate for the softness of the floor, which can increase sailing. In high winds, this requires more frequent operation with oars or motor to hold the course. Installation of anchors and proper anchoring solves the problem of parking.
Can the inflatable floor be replaced with plywood in case of damage?
Structurally, the NDND and NDD are different: In a boat designed for the inflatable floor, there is no stringer system and locks to fix rigid floorboards. You can put plywood in there, but it will lie unstable, which is dangerous. It is better to repair the inflatable floor: modern remixes and two-component adhesives allow you to restore tightness even in severe cuts.
